Keys to the Classroom

A Teacher’s Guide to the First Month Of School

This practical, easy-to-use workbook provides lesson plans, classroom management strategies, student assessments, and special aids for teaching bilingual students. Everything any teacher needs to start the school year off positively and powerfully! From organizing the first day to sample letters to parents in English and Spanish – this book will help even the veteran teacher create a positive classroom environment.

This updated Second Edition offers expanded material to respond to today’s challenges:

  • New first chapter – Guide to Planning
  • An extensive two-week plan for K-6
  • New field-tested activities
  • Up-to-date assessment material
  • Expanded ESL sections

Developed by five advisors with the California New Teacher Project, this book includes input of many new an veteran teachers and has been field-tested in the Santa Cruz County New Teacher Project – with rave reviews from beginning, second year, and veteran teachers.


By Carrol Moran, Judy Stobbe, Wendy Baron, Janette Miller, Ellen Moir
June 2000
240 pages
Handbook format: 8 1/2” x 11”
